#4c6967 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4c6967 is composed of 29.8% red, 41.2%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.9%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 175.9 degrees, a saturation of 16% and a lightness of 35.5%. #4c6967 color hex could be obtained by blending #98d2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#4c6967 color description : Very dark grayish cyan.
The hexadecimal color #4c6967 has RGB values of R:76, G:105,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 5007719.
